Taylor Blackmore is an alum of ASU's film school and graduated in Spring of 2018 with a BA in FIlm and Media Production. Since then they have worked as a freelancer in the Phoenix valley as a videographer, photographer and editor. They have shot over 100 weddings, memorial services and live concerts, spent 2 years as a preschool photographer and served as a freelance editor for the Phoenix-based non-profit CALA Alliance (Celebración Artística de las Américas) which collaborates with artists and arts organizations to nurture artistic talent, focusing on artists from the Latin American diaspora.
Blackmore has since returned to The Sidney Poitier New American Film School as the Communications Program Coordinator and gets to celebrate and promote the stories of its students, faculty and staff through internal and external marketing and communication initiatives. They also teach a beginning post production class for Adobe Premiere (FMP 215).
